About this role
The Opportunity
We're building the next generation of AI-native product experiences, where conversations turn directly into outcomes. As a Software Engineer on the Activation team, you'll work at the intersection of product, growth, and systems — shaping how users discover the product, activate into it, and bring others along with them. You'll work across the full lifecycle of growth features, from the backend systems that power onboarding and sharing flows to the instrumentation that tells us what's actually working. This role requires balancing product thinking with sound engineering, ensuring that the experiences we build are not only effective at driving growth, but also reliable, well-instrumented, and built to iterate on. You'll partner closely with product, design, and data to ship and improve experiences like invite flows, activation nudges, and sharing mechanics — turning growth hypotheses into high-quality product features.
Your Impact
Build and iterate on backend systems that power core activation features — onboarding, sharing, invite flows, and notification pipelines
Instrument new features with analytics events to measure funnel conversion and user behavior, in close collaboration with data partners
Participate in A/B experiments: support test setup, interpret results, and help translate findings into product decisions
Write clean, well-tested, maintainable code that your teammates can build confidently on top of
Contribute actively to design reviews, sprint planning, and team retrospectives
Surface and address problems in existing systems — not just within your assigned scope
We're looking for someone who
Holds a Bachelor's degree in Computer Science or a related field, or has equivalent practical experience
Has 2–4 years of backend software engineering experience, with a track record of shipping user-facing features
Has working experience with Python and a backend web framework such as Django ;
Is familiar with relational databases ( MySQL or similar) and has some exposure to NoSQL or high-performance data stores such as DynamoDB , Cassandra , or Redis — and understands when to reach for each
Has some exposure to cloud infrastructure, ideally AWS (EC2, S3, or similar services)
Has some exposure to product analytics or A/B testing, and is eager to develop deeper fluency
Thinks about user outcomes alongside technical correctness when making engineering decisions
Communicates clearly and works well across functions — with product, design, and data partners
Is comfortable navigating ambiguity and making progress without a fully-specified design
About Otter.ai
We are in the business of shaping the future of work. Our mission is to make conversations more valuable.
With over 1B meetings transcribed, Otter.ai is the world’s leading tool for meeting transcription, summarization, and collaboration. Using artificial intelligence, Otter generates real-time automated meeting notes, summaries, and other insights from in-person and virtual meetings - turning meetings into accessible, collaborative, and actionable data that can be shared across teams and organizations. The company is backed by early investors in Google, DeepMind, Zoom, and Tesla.

Salary range
Salary Range: $136,000 to $185,000 USD per year.
This salary range represents the low and high end of the estimated salary range for this position. The actual base salary offered for the role is dependent on several factors. Our base salary is just one component of a comprehensive total rewards package.
